在数据分析的过程中,数据的质量至关重要。SPSS作为一款强大的统计分析软件,在数据修改和清洗方面提供了丰富的功能。本文将详细介绍SPSS中数据修改与清洗的技巧,帮助您轻松掌握数据处理的精髓。
一、数据视图与编辑视图
SPSS提供两种视图:数据视图和编辑视图。数据视图以表格形式展示数据,便于查看和编辑;编辑视图则可以逐个输入或修改数据。
1.1 数据视图
- 数据浏览:在数据视图中,您可以浏览数据,查看数据的基本信息,如变量类型、标签、值等。
- 数据编辑:直接在数据视图中修改数据,如替换值、删除记录等。
1.2 编辑视图
- 逐个输入:在编辑视图中,可以逐个输入数据,方便进行数据清洗。
- 批量输入:支持从外部文件导入数据,如CSV、Excel等。
二、数据修改技巧
2.1 替换值
- 替换:使用“替换”功能,可以将满足条件的原始值替换为新的值。
- 条件替换:根据条件进行替换,如将小于0的值替换为0。
REPLACE variable1 = variable1 IF variable1 < 0 WITH 0.
2.2 删除记录
- 删除:使用“删除”功能,可以删除满足条件的记录。
- 条件删除:根据条件删除记录,如删除缺失值的记录。
DELETE IF variable1 IS missing.
2.3 删除变量
- 删除:使用“删除”功能,可以删除不需要的变量。
- 条件删除:根据条件删除变量,如删除所有缺失值的变量。
DROP IF variable1 IS missing.
三、数据清洗技巧
3.1 缺失值处理
- 删除缺失值:删除含有缺失值的记录或变量。
- 插补缺失值:使用均值、中位数等方法插补缺失值。
REPLACE variable1 = mean(variable1) IF variable1 IS missing.
3.2 异常值处理
- 识别异常值:使用箱线图、散点图等方法识别异常值。
- 删除异常值:删除满足条件的异常值。
DELETE IF variable1 > 1000 AND variable1 < 0.
3.3 数据转换
- 标准化:将数据转换为标准正态分布。
- 对数转换:将数据转换为对数分布。
COMPUTE variable1 = LOG(variable1).
四、总结
SPSS数据修改与清洗是数据分析的重要环节。通过掌握这些技巧,您可以轻松应对各种数据问题,提高数据质量。在实际操作中,请根据具体需求选择合适的方法,确保数据分析的准确性和可靠性。
